The Internet lacks a protocol for money. Lightspark is building the tools and services to make it happen. Lightspark builds enterprise-ready infrastructure for open payments for the Internet at scale using the Lightning Network. An always-on, low-cost, universal payment network will completely transform how money is moved, enabling businesses and developers to transform existing solutions and build new financial systems, services, and processes accessible to everyone, transcending geographical restraints. Lightspark is headquartered in Los Angeles, California, but serves the world.

As a Product Manager - Global Network Rollout, you will oversee the connectivity of our payments network with domestic payment systems worldwide. You’ll work closely with cross-functional teams, including engineering, design, compliance, and business development, to ensure that we select the right partners and build the right solutions to meet the needs of our customers and align with the company’s strategic goals.  At Lightspark, we’re a fast-growing startup where grit, hustle,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ment are essential. We need people ready to roll up their sleeves and build detailed money movement solutions at scale as we build the future of payment infrastructure. 

What you’ll be doing:

  • Drive the end-to-end product lifecycle for our global network rollout solutions, from ideation to launch, ensuring alignment with business objectives and customer needs.

  • Develop and document payment system architectures, including integration with third-party payment gateways, fraud prevention systems, and compliance mechanisms.

  • Conduct market research to identify trends, customer needs, and competitive landscape to inform product development.

  • Stay current with emerging technologies and trends in payment systems and incorporate relevant advancements into solution designs: on & off ramps, settlement, customer onboarding, ledger capabilities. 

  • Be responsible for designing robust, scalable, and secure payment solutions.

  • Work closely with internal stakeholders, including engineering, design, compliance, and business development teams, to define product requirements and prioritize features.

  • Be the product owner during the product development lifecycle, ensuring timely delivery of features and enhancements that optimize the product efficiency.

  • Understand and incorporate regulatory and compliance requirements into the product development process, with a focus on AML, licensing, and payment industry standards.

  • Collaborate with the design team to create intuitive and user-friendly payment experiences.

  • Define and track key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ure the success of payment products and inform future development.

What we’re looking for:

  • 7+ years of experience in global payment infrastructure product management, preferably in early stage and fast pace environment payment, fintech, or financial services.

  • Experience with taking a US based payments provider global.

  • Familiarity with payment systems, payment rails, and the regulatory environment (AML, licensing, compliance). Strong knowledge of the payment vendor landscape.

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to translate complex requirements into actionable product documentation 

  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ively in cross-functional teams.

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, or a related field is ideal but not required.  We appreciate and acknowledge that some of the best talent comes from non-traditional backgrounds. 

  • Experience building 0 to 1

  • Knowledge of modern product management tools
